Output 8dc6fc42141880ebcaa6ce5db5d902f35db90826dc982a03707003e0b481eb3d:4

value
665297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869a0dfb950011fd7342f4bc80ca99a892c13c44 OP_EQUAL
address
3Dxj29kXMtPz4kRDSHBJRiyGGeFHS3mgNp
transaction
8dc6fc42141880ebcaa6ce5db5d902f35db90826dc982a03707003e0b481eb3d
confirmations
324407
spent
true